Sewage Water Removal Cost in Murray, UT

The cost of Sewage Water Removal in Murray, UT can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500, with the average cost being around $1,500.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$100 – $500 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Sewage Water Removal $500 – $2,000 Amount of water and type of equ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and type of equipment needed
Cleaning and Disinfection $100 – $500 Size of affected area and type of equipment needed
Equipment Rental $50 – $200 Duration of rental and type of equipment needed
Travel Fee $25 – $100 Distance from our office to your location

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ment and may vary based on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. We offer free estimates and are happy to discuss your specific situation with you.

Q: How do I prevent sewage water damage?

A: To prevent sewage water damage, it’s essential to regularly inspect your pipes and drains for signs of wear and tear. You should also consider installing a backflow prevention device to prevent sewage water from backing up into your home.

Q: What are the health risks associated with sewage water damage?

A: Sewage water damage can pose serious health risks, including the spread of bacteria, viruses, and other contaminants. It’s essential to act fast to prevent further damage and health risks.
